MVR, standing for Mechanical Vapor Recompression, is an innovative and eco-friendly energy-saving technology. It dramatically minimizes the need for additional external energy by ingeniously repurposing the secondary steam energy it generates during the process. The fundamental brilliance of MVR lies in its mechanism, where the secondary steam produced by the evaporator is efficiently compressed using a high-performance steam compressor. This process transforms electrical energy into thermal energy, escalating both the pressure and the temperature of the secondary steam. This thermal transformation allows the secondary steam to return to the evaporator, where it heats the materials, inducing further evaporation. This clever cycle effectively recycles the latent heat of vaporization from the secondary steam, optimizing energy efficiency and reinforcing economic value.
The DML series low temperature rise steam compressor is a sophisticated piece of equipment, meticulously constructed for optimal performance. Its primary structure includes a comprehensive compressor body, which encompasses components such as the volute, impeller, main shaft, bearing housing, and seal. Additionally, it is equipped with a coupling, motor, and electric instruments, all harmoniously integrated to ensure seamless operation and superior efficiency.
3.3.1 Gracefully position the compressor base on the foundation. Utilize wedge-shaped shims beneath to ensure precise leveling. These shims artfully support and stabilize your setup.
Alternately arrange two wedge-shaped irons. Once the unit achieves perfect balance, firmly spot weld the irons in 4 to 5 strategic points for an unyielding hold.
Users are encouraged to customize the manufacture and installation of wedges based on specific conditions. Ensure smooth, even contact surfaces for optimal performance.
The wedge's bearing capacity is remarkably engineered, not exceeding 40Kg/cm2).
3.3.2 Employ a level to achieve unparalleled precision. The unit's axial level should be an impeccable 0.05/1000mm, while the horizontal level boasts a flawless 0.10/1000mm.
Such meticulous leveling ensures an unwavering foundation for peak performance.
3.3.3 Achieve impeccable alignment with the coupling, ensuring that all preliminary conditions are thoroughly met:
1) Safely disengage the main power supply for secure handling.
2) Carefully remove the coupling shield to unveil the alignment area.
3) Extract the diaphragm coupling's intermediate section for comprehensive access.
4) Inspect the motor installation plane to verify the absence of contaminants, ensuring a pristine surface.
5) Ensure motor bolt holes offer ample clearance to facilitate effortless adjustments.
6) Arm yourself with a wealth of stainless steel gaskets. Achieve seamless contact and avoid using inadequate adjustments.
7) Select a precision instrument, be it a dial indicator or laser alignment meter with 0.01mm accuracy, tailored just for you.
8) Prepare a reliable bracket to support the dial indicator, as illustrated below.
9) Employ the motor wheel hub mounting bracket to deftly position a dial indicator probe on the compressor wheel hub's edge.
10) Adjust with finesse, aligning the center lines of the motor and compressor. Maintain an outer circle deviation of just 0.05mm, with the motor shaft center line slightly elevated.
11) Conclude by securely tightening the motor foot bolts, and assess the coupling's outer circle and end face runout for ultimate precision;
12) Following a successful motor idling test, reassemble the coupling's intermediate section.
3.3.4 Perfectly tune the 'levelness' and alignment of the casing. Secure the anchor bolts firmly. After mechanical operation, loosen and retighten for unwavering stability.
3.3.5 Safeguard the high-speed rotating impeller from foreign intrusion. Ensure all connecting pipelines are pristine, meeting stringent steam corrosion standards. If necessary, install solid-liquid separation equipment for added protection.
3.3.6 Seamlessly install the compressor inlet and outlet pipes. Adhere to PI diagram specifications for all pipeline accessories. Independently support pipelines to avoid burdening the compressor body.
3.3.7 Once the main fan, along with its associated equipment, has been meticulously installed and the concrete foundation has reached full solidification, the stage is set to commence the compressor operation test. This crucial phase ensures optimal performance and reliability.
3.3.8 The electric control cabinet for the compressor should be strategically positioned within a 5-meter radius of the compressor itself. Ensuring seamless connectivity, the wiring should be expertly routed through underground threading pipe. Once the electric control cabinet is precisely placed, it is essential to skillfully connect the wiring terminals in the cabinet to the remote DCS lines, facilitating effective communication and control.

1. Our fan impellers are meticulously crafted using precision mold forging, with the use of duplex stainless steel materials. This choice imbues the product with exceptional anti-corrosive properties and remarkable wear resistance, ensuring longevity and durability.
2. We utilize SKF rolling bearings coupled with oil spray lubrication, a combination that guarantees smooth operation and enhances the overall performance and efficiency of our products.
3. The shaft seal is engineered with a carbon ring seal structure, complemented by an inflation or vacuum unit. This technology ensures a robust isolation between the bearing housing and the compressor volute, safeguarding the internal components.
4. Our compressor units feature an innovative integral skid-mounted design, making them extremely convenient for both transportation and installation, saving you time and effort in logistics and setup.
5. Boasting a high degree of automation, our systems are effortlessly easy to handle, with real-time monitoring capabilities for parameters such as pressure and vibration. By utilizing frequency control, these systems adapt to variable working conditions, ensuring the compressor runs with optimal efficiency at all times.
